He decided to have all his hair and beard shaved off for charity and has raised £245 for Pendleside Hospice and Macmillan Cancer Care.
Gordon's achievement is extra special because he is a vulnerable adult with special needs and eight years ago he was an alcoholic and his life was quite chaotic.

Listing fishing and CB radio among his hobbies, Gordon has a personal assistant Chris Morris, who works for All Care. Laura Hodgkinson, who is a personal health budger planner for the Be Well team at Burnley's Calico, also works with Gordon.
Laura said: "Gordon has worked really hard to turn his life around.
"Despite the challenges of lockdown he took it upon himself to raise money for two fantastic causes and I am really proud of what Gordon has achieved."

At the moment he is decorating his home but he is planning more charity challenges in the future.
